We allow the noise to be a cylindrical Wiener process and admit an unbounded linear operator in the state equation. Our assumptions cover, for instance, controlled heat equations with space-time white noise. Our main result is to prove that if K is $\\varepsilon$-viable, then the square of the distance from K: $d_K^2(x):= \\inf_{y\\in K}|x-y|^2$ is a viscosity supersolution of a suitable class of fully nonlinear Hamilton\u2013Jacobi\u2013Bellman equations in H. This extends already obtained results into the finite dimensional case. We use the definition of viscosity supersolutions for \u201cunbounded\u201d elliptic equations in infinite variables that have been recently introduced by \u015awi\u0119ch and Kelome.
